Description
GitLab is looking for an Intermediate Backend Engineer to join the Developer Experience team, focusing on Developer Tooling. The role involves enhancing the developer feedback loop and workflow efficiency for GitLab projects by measuring and optimizing project processes. The ideal candidate will appreciate contributing to the mission of enabling everyone to co-create software and will thrive in a supportive, all-remote work environment.
Responsibilities
Build automated measurements and dashboards for insights into engineering productivity.
Enhance developer productivity through measurement-driven improvements.
Utilize GitLab product features to improve developer workflow and provide feedback.
Participate in activities related to engineering throughput and KPIs.
Develop automated processes to support product and engineering workflows.
Enhance and add features to the GitLab product to improve engineer productivity.
Requirements
Experience developing in Ruby.
Experience with test automation frameworks for both front-end and back-end testing.
Experience in designing and developing tools and solutions used across teams.
Development experience with object-oriented programming languages and patterns.
Excellent oral and written communication skills.
Experience with a front-end charting/visualization library.
Experience using test automation tools such as Selenium, Capybara, or Watir.
Experience with Continuous Integration systems like GitLab CI, Jenkins, or Travis.
